On June 9, Dr. Gulsun Yildirim, Associate Professor of Tourism College of Recep Tayyip Erdogan University of Turkey, was invited by the School of Agricultural Engineering of GVTC to give a webinar entitled “Overview of Turkish Tea Culture” to more than 400 teachers and students from Major Group of Tea Tree Cultivation and Tea Leaf Processing.
Dr. Gulsun mainly showed the audience the unique tea culture in Turkey from several aspects, including the history of tea culture development in Turkey, tea planting and processing in Turkey, traditional tea boiling methods, tea rituals, and tea customs, as well as Turkish tea-drinking habits, etc. In her lecture, Dr. Gulsun introduced that Turkish people love tea as much as Chinese people do. Unlike China, Turkey does not have Tea Art, and there is no special ceremony for drinking tea. But tea is everywhere, and drinking tea has become a part of their cultural life.
